Job description

Our client, based in the Bedford area, is looking to recruit a Manual Machinist.

Main Purpose:

The main purpose of the role is to produce machined tooling components using various metal machining centres, operating independently. Although primarily focused on the automotive sector, the role also involves industrial engineering projects in sectors such as logistics and agriculture.

Key Responsibilities:
  1. Set and operate machines in line with production times and drawing specifications.
  2. Select and load suitable cutting tools to optimize time and cost.
  3. Produce quality components according to specifications and tolerances.
  4. Supervise machine operations and make adjustments for better results.
  5. Inspect and measure components using appropriate devices to ensure standards.
  6. Produce parts within acceptable timescales as directed by the line manager.
  7. Pay attention to detail, maintaining good eyesight (with glasses if required).
  8. Resolve any problems that arise during machining.
  9. Maintain flexibility in daily tasks and responsibilities.
  10. Follow health and safety protocols to ensure a safe working environment.
  11. Keep the work area clean and tidy.
Experience and Qualifications:
  1. Ideally, time-served or completed an apprenticeship as a miller and/or turner, with previous experience in a machine shop environment.
  2. Strong attention to detail and ability to read and interpret 2D drawings.
  3. Ability to work collaboratively with other workshop disciplines.
  4. Willingness to develop new skills both within and outside your core discipline.
  5. Good communication skills (oral, reading, writing).
  6. Ability to analyze and solve problems as they arise.
Additional Information:

The successful candidate should be self-motivated, a team player, and experienced in machining, with skills in multiple disciplines to produce high-quality machined items. Ideally, you will be apprenticeship trained and competent in working safely from technical drawings, maintaining high standards of workmanship, cleanliness, and adhering to timescales.

Terms:
  • The position is permanent, based on 40 hours per week.
  • Salary is based on experience, knowledge, and competence.
  • Access to the company pension scheme.
  • 22 days of annual holiday, increasing by 1 day per year up to 25 days.

Skills required include manual machining, manual lathes, mills, and CNC.
